Motor configuration properties

Rotational speed

33 rpm

Torque

308Ncm

Power

10.78 W

Supply Voltage

1~24 V

Frequency

50Hz

Total current

1710mA

Input power

44 w

Capacitor

120uF

Coil overtemperature

105ºC

Rotational speed solo motor

1000 rpm

Torque solo motor

21Ncm

self-holding torque

2.6Ncm

Gear

Worm gear type S

Gear ratio

30:1

Gear efficiency

0.49

Permissible output torque

12Nm

Output shaft diameter

10mm g7

Max. axial load

100N

Max. radial load

150 N

Overall length without integrated electronics

188mm

Overall length with integrated electronics

232mm

Gear type

Worm Gear

electronics

Standard without control electronics.
